| Tairent::AzDHT::AzDHTModule | Module for communicating with AzDHT program |
| Tairent::AzDHTTracker::AzDHTTrackerModule | Implementation of DHT tracker |
| Tairent::Core::BEncode | Class that is used to hold bencoded informations |
| Tairent::Core::BEncodeException | Exception that is raised by BEncode class |
| Tairent::Core::BitField | BitField is an array of bits |
| Tairent::Main::Connection | Connection between two torrent clients |
| Tairent::Control::Connection | Connection between control server and its client |
| Tairent::Control::ControlModule | Module for controlling the application |
| Tairent::Main::FilePositionStruct | Struct containing informations about file's offset and its length |
| Tairent::Main::FileStruct | Struct for file descriptor and number of references to the file |
| Tairent::Main::HashChecker | HashChecker is used to check a piece against its hash |
| Tairent::Main::HashCheckerThread | Thread for hash checking |
| Tairent::TrackerClient::HTTPTrackerClient | Tracker client for http protocol |
| Tairent::TrackerClient::HTTPTrackerClientFactory | Factory for creating tracker clients for http protocol |
| Tairent::TrackerClient::HTTPTrackerClientModule | Module that provides tracker client factory for http protocol |
| Tairent::Main::MainModule | Main BitTorrent client module |
| Tairent::Main::MainThread | Main applications thread |
| Tairent::Core::NetThread | Thread for networking |
| Tairent::Main::PeerStruct | |
| Tairent::Main::PieceReadersStruct | Struct for informations about piece readers |
| Tairent::Main::PieceRequestStruct | Struct with informations about one peer's request |
| Tairent::Main::PieceStruct | Struct for informations about piece mapped to the memory |
| Tairent::Main::PieceStruct::FilePieceStruct | Struct for part of the piece that belongs to one file |
| Tairent::Main::PieceWritersStruct | Struct for informations about piece writers |
| PreferredPeerLess | Class for comparing PreferredPeerStructs |
| PreferredPeerStruct | |
| Tairent::Main::RateMeasurer | Class for measuring transfer rates |
| Tairent::Main::RequestStruct | Struct for piece's requests |
| Tairent::Main::Storage | Storage is an abstraction layer over filesystem |
| Tairent::Main::TorrentClient | TorrentClient manages running of one torrent |
| Tairent::Main::TorrentManager | TorrentManager keeps informations about managed torrents |
| Tairent::Main::TorrentServer | Server accepting incomming connections for torrents |
| Tairent::Main::TorrentStruct | Holds informations about managed torrents |
| Tairent::Main::TrackerClient | Base class for trackers |
| Tairent::Main::TrackerClientFactory | Base class for factories that create tracker clients |
| Tairent::Main::TrackerManager | TrackerManager keeps informations about trackers for various protocols |
1.4.7